易语言编程无法进行编辑的原因有三个:1、环境配置不正确,2、软件版本不兼容,3、代码保护功能被启用。
在讨论显著影响易语言编程编辑功能的环境配置问题时,需要我们仔细考察。环境配置不正确可能涉及到操作系统的设置、易语言软件的安装路径以及其他相关软件或插件的兼容性问题。这些因素能够直接导致易语言的编辑器无法启动或者在编辑过程中发生崩溃,从而影响编程效率和体验。正确配置环境不仅能够避免上述问题的发生,还能够保证编程过程的流畅性和代码执行的稳定性。
一、环境配置不正确
环境配置的正确性对易语言编程至关重要。它包括操作系统的设置、易语言软件的安装路径选择,以及必要的辅助软件或插件的安装。如果环境配置出现错误,比如路径设置不当或者缺少必要的支持库,都可能导致易语言编辑器无法正常工作。
二、软件版本不兼容
软件版本的兼容性也是编辑时常见问题。随着软件的更新,新版本可能不再兼容旧版本的某些特性或代码。如果开发者在未详细阅读版本更新说明的情况下盲目升级,可能会发现之前的项目无法打开或编辑。
三、代码保护功能被启用
代码保护是易语言提供的一项功能,旨在保护开发者的代码不被他人轻易查看或修改。一旦这一功能被启用,未经授权的编辑操作将会被限制。这种保护措施虽好,但同时也增加了在需要时对代码进行修改的难度。
易语言编程是一个功能强大的开发工具,但要确保其编辑功能正常使用,需要注意以上几点。环境配置的正确性、软件版本间的兼容性检查以及合理使用代码保护功能,都是碎片化处理这个问题的关键所在。通过仔细排查和校正这些常见错误,开发者可以有效解决编辑中遇到的问题,提高编程效率和项目质量。
相关问答FAQs:
Q: 为什么易语言编程不能编辑?
A: 易语言编程之所以不能编辑是因为其采用了一种所谓的“封装”技术。在易语言中,程序代码被编译成一种不可逆的形式,称为“封装代码”。这种封装代码可以被执行,但是无法被逆向工程师或其他人修改。
Q: 那么为什么易语言选择使用封装技术呢?
A: 易语言选择使用封装技术主要有两个原因。首先,封装可以防止他人对代码的恶意修改或盗取。由于封装代码无法被逆向工程师修改,因此可以保护开发者的知识产权和商业利益。其次,封装可以提高代码的执行效率。封装后的代码更加紧凑,执行速度更快,因此易语言在一些对性能要求较高的场景中应用广泛。
Q: 那么有没有办法绕过易语言的封装,对程序进行编辑呢?
A: 一般情况下,无法直接对易语言的封装代码进行编辑。然而,如果你具备一定的逆向工程知识和技能,可能可以使用一些专门的工具进行反汇编和逆向分析。通过这种方式,你可以尝试还原易语言的封装代码,并对其进行一定程度的修改。但需要注意的是,这涉及到逆向工程的领域,法律上存在不确定因素,因此不建议进行非法反向工程操作。
总的来说,易语言采用封装技术是为了保护程序代码和提高性能,虽然不能直接编辑,但可以通过逆向工程的方法对封装代码进行还原和修改,但需要遵守法律法规和知识产权的保护。
文章标题:易语言编程为什么不能编辑,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1611122